>> Former state Board of Education member Kim Coco Iwamoto is a Democrat running for lieutenant governor this year. A list of candidates for that office was incomplete in a story on Page A1 Monday.

>> The Year of the Dog Postal Service stamp — the first stamp of the New Year to be issued Jan. 11 — features a cut-paper design of a dog by the late Hawaii graphic design icon Clarence Lee. A story on Page B2 Saturday contained inaccurate information.
